Remote patient monitoring (RPM) involves the use of digital health technologies to collect and transmit patient data from remote locations to healthcare providers for monitoring and management of chronic conditions, post-acute care, and preventive interventions. In 2024, the market for remote patient monitoring is experiencing significant growth, driven by the increasing prevalence of chronic diseases, the aging population, and the demand for virtual care solutions amid the COVID-19 pandemic. Remote patient monitoring solutions encompass wearable devices, mobile applications, telehealth platforms, and remote monitoring software, enabling continuous monitoring of vital signs, symptoms, medication adherence, and lifestyle factors outside of traditional healthcare settings. These technologies empower patients to actively participate in their care, facilitate early detection of health deterioration, and support personalized care plans tailored to individual needs and preferences. With advancements in sensor technology, data analytics, and artificial intelligence, remote patient monitoring offers opportunities for proactive intervention, risk stratification, and predictive analytics to prevent complications, reduce hospitalizations, and improve patient outcomes. As healthcare delivery models continue to evolve towards patient-centered, value-based care, remote patient monitoring plays a crucial role in enhancing care accessibility, efficiency, and effectiveness while reducing healthcare costs and disparities.
A prominent trend in the remote patient monitoring market is the widespread adoption of wearable health technologies. With the increasing prevalence of chronic diseases, aging populations, and the shift towards value-based care, there's a growing demand for remote patient monitoring solutions that enable continuous monitoring of patients' health outside of traditional healthcare settings. Wearable devices, such as smartwatches, fitness trackers, and medical-grade sensors, offer real-time tracking of vital signs, activity levels, and other health metrics, allowing healthcare providers to remotely monitor patients' health status, detect early warning signs, and intervene promptly when necessary. This trend reflects the convergence of healthcare and consumer electronics industries, driving innovation in wearable health technologies and expanding the scope of remote patient monitoring to encompass preventive care, chronic disease management, and post-acute care monitoring.
A key driver propelling the growth of the remote patient monitoring market is the need to reduce healthcare costs and improve patient outcomes. Remote patient monitoring enables proactive management of chronic conditions, early detection of health deterioration, and timely interventions to prevent costly hospitalizations and complications. Additionally, remote monitoring empowers patients to take an active role in managing their health, promoting self-care behaviors, medication adherence, and lifestyle modifications. By leveraging remote patient monitoring solutions, healthcare providers can optimize resource utilization, reduce healthcare utilization rates, and achieve better clinical outcomes, thereby addressing the challenges of rising healthcare costs, population aging, and the burden of chronic diseases.
An emerging opportunity in the remote patient monitoring market lies in the integration of telehealth services and artificial intelligence (AI). Telehealth platforms offer virtual care delivery options, such as video consultations, remote visits, and asynchronous messaging, which complement remote patient monitoring by enabling real-time communication between patients and healthcare providers. By integrating telehealth services with remote patient monitoring systems, healthcare organizations can offer comprehensive virtual care solutions that encompass both monitoring and care delivery, improving access to healthcare services, particularly in underserved or rural areas. Moreover, AI-driven analytics and predictive modeling capabilities enhance remote patient monitoring by analyzing large volumes of patient data, identifying trends, and providing actionable insights for personalized care planning and intervention strategies. By embracing the integration of telehealth and AI technologies, companies can capitalize on the opportunity to deliver more efficient, effective, and patient-centered remote patient monitoring solutions that drive better outcomes and experiences for both patients and providers.
Among the provided segments, Services & Software are the fastest growing in the Remote Patient Monitoring Market. This growth can be attributed to several factors. Firstly, the increasing adoption of remote patient monitoring (RPM) solutions to manage chronic diseases and monitor patients in real-time drives the demand for comprehensive services and software platforms. Services & Software encompass various functionalities such as data analytics, patient engagement tools, telehealth capabilities, and care coordination features, which are essential for effective remote patient monitoring programs. Additionally, advancements in digital health technologies and interoperability standards have led to the development of integrated RPM platforms that can aggregate and analyze patient data from diverse monitoring devices, facilitating proactive care management and timely interventions. Furthermore, the COVID-19 pandemic has accelerated the adoption of telemedicine and remote patient monitoring solutions, leading to increased investments in services & software to support remote care delivery models. Moreover, the shift towards value-based care and population health management initiatives further drives the demand for services & software that enable remote patient monitoring, care coordination, and outcomes tracking across various healthcare settings. As a result, Services & Software emerge as the fastest growing segment in the Remote Patient Monitoring Market, addressing the evolving needs of healthcare providers and patients for remote care management effectively.
